Tea's Health Perks Depend on Brewing Method, Study Reveals

Brewed tea delivers the most significant health benefits, according to a new scientific review published in *Beverage Plant Research*, while processed bottled or bubble teas often negate these perks with added sugar and additives. The study links regular consumption of properly brewed tea, particularly green tea, to reduced risks of heart disease, cancer, diabetes, and cognitive decline. However, heat treatment during processing and prolonged shelf life can degrade beneficial compounds like polyphenols and catechins.

Dietitians emphasize that maximizing benefits requires using whole-leaf tea and minimizing or eliminating sugar, as added ingredients often outweigh the tea's inherent advantages. This finding underscores the importance of preparation method over mere consumption frequency for health-conscious individuals.
